Transaction 07aeafce89e3237ab86d854d9131e486e595425fe149583ba716a9e56fb6e2dc
1 Input
2 Outputs
- 07aeafce89e3237ab86d854d9131e486e595425fe149583ba716a9e56fb6e2dc:0
- 07aeafce89e3237ab86d854d9131e486e595425fe149583ba716a9e56fb6e2dc:1
value 8858028
address 18bWULkYR377hN9s7idWvTbYbKeCf2x7Pv
value 24226466
address 179SSTKDFVWgLCRGqzcWtL2tjAKpJPgEAf